I seem to be the odd ball in my parts but here's how I start :
Loosen up my back , light stretching (can't do anything with out that
) ,
Start with table length straight in shots , OB-CB about 12" apart ,
Gradually spread OB-CB when that get's locked in till I end up about half the table apart ,
Add some draw and force to that ,
Few minutes of "boxed 1 pocket" ( 9-10 balls placed around corner pocket in a square layout ) untill I can run it a couple times ,
Few breaks (in a row) till the CB can be parked comfortably ,
Then I'm good to go. Seems like alot maybe but take me like 20-25 mins.
